Output 602ed3aa1b0c0af596c08d3f26e822acc53db6db1d0e19a326dee1157d964c6d:0

value
23594590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198b277163291a59fb21c21e0d701bb69f6eb499 OP_EQUAL
address
MAEDppYS4cdmE5Xcn22CH7JaHYjEFQ3yCo
transaction
602ed3aa1b0c0af596c08d3f26e822acc53db6db1d0e19a326dee1157d964c6d
spent
true